In adult populations, embedded performance validity indicators are well established, as they are time efficient, resistant to coaching, and allow for more continuous monitoring of effort than standalone measures. Although several recent studies have demonstrated the appropriateness of using standalone validity tests with school-age children, a paucity of pediatric work has examined embedded indicators. The present study investigated the value of a simple automatized sequences task to detect performance invalidity in 439 clinically referred patients with mild head injury aged 8 through 17 years. Sixteen percent of the participants failed the Medical Symptom Validity Test (MSVT). Thirteen percent failed the MSVT and also performed below established cutoffs on either the Test of Memory Malingering or Wechsler Digit Span subtest. The group classified as providing invalid data performed significantly worse than the group passing the MSVT across all sequencing conditions. Sensitivity and specificity for the total time on the sequencing task compared favorably to data produced for many respected adult-based embedded indicators (i.e., sensitivity around 50% when specificity ≥ 90%). Classification statistics for any embedded performance validity test can be expected to be worse in more severely affected populations; however, the current sequencing task appears to have value in detecting invalid performance in relatively high-functioning older children and adolescents. The fact that the task takes less than a couple of minutes to administer makes it especially appealing.  相似文献

Sixty-six primary school children were selected, of which 21 scored low on a standardized math achievement test, 23 were normal, and 22 high achievers. In a numerical Stroop experiment, children were asked to make numerical and physical size comparisons on digit pairs. The effects of congruity and numerical distance were determined. All children exhibited congruity and distance effects in the numerical comparison. In the physical comparison, children of all performance groups showed Stroop effects when the numerical distance between the digits was large but failed to show them when the distance was small. Numerical distance effects depended on the congruity condition, with a typical effect of distance in the congruent, and a reversed distance effect in the incongruent condition. Our results are hard to reconcile with theories that suggest that deficits in the automaticity of numerical processing can be related to differential math achievement levels. Immaturity in the precision of mappings between numbers and their numerical magnitudes might be better suited to explain the Stroop effects in children. However, as the results for the high achievers demonstrate, in addition to numerical processing capacity per se, domain-general functions might play a crucial role in Stroop performance, too.  相似文献

Neuropsychological test interpretation rests upon the assumption that the examinee has exerted full effort. If an individual provides inadequate effort during exam, the resulting data will be invalid and represent an underestimate of the person's true abilities. Although youth have been assumed historically to be less capable of deception than adults, acts of deception in childhood are not uncommon, even in normative populations. Yet, very few cases of children who have provided suboptimal effort during neuropsychological exam have appeared in the scientific literature. We present six clinical cases illustrating that children down to at least age 8 years can present with noncredible performance. The cases include those in which clear external incentives could be identified to those in which intrinsic or psychological factors were presumed to predominate. The fairly diverse nature of the presented cases, along with other recent work, suggests that suboptimal effort in children is apt to occur more frequently than previously recognized, even if it might occur less often than in comparable adult samples. In most of the presented cases, noncredible performance would not have been detected definitively by clinical judgment alone, reinforcing the value of routinely incorporating symptom validity tests into the neuropsychological assessment of school-aged children. The number of effort tests that have demonstrated utility in children pales in comparison to those available to the adult practitioner, although recent research now supports the use of several standalone measures with pediatric patients.  相似文献

A unique structure, a network of nanotwins, is revealed for the first time in high-energy ion-irradiated YBa2Cu3O7-delta. This structure is shown to form only at ion doses of 1011 cm-2 or greater and thus is not revealed in any earlier electron microscopy studies. In this higher-dose regime, the well known columnar defects are connected by the nanotwin structure, thus affecting bulk superconducting properties. Consequences for a number of published interpretations of such measurements related to pinning and dynamics of magnetic vortices are discussed.  相似文献

Mindfulness: Theoretical Foundations and Evidence for its Salutary Effects   总被引:1,自引:0,他引:1  
Interest in mindfulness and its enhancement has burgeoned in recent years. In this article, we discuss in detail the nature of mindfulness and its relation to other, established theories of attention and awareness in day-to-day life. We then examine theory and evidence for the role of mindfulness in curtailing negative functioning and enhancing positive outcomes in several important life domains, including mental health, physical health, behavioral regulation, and interpersonal relationships. The processes through which mindfulness is theorized to have its beneficial effects are then discussed, along with proposed directions for theoretical development and empirical research.  相似文献

The present research examined the extent to which sleep disturbance is involved in the experience of test anxiety. In Study 1, a sample of 80 subjects completed a trait measure of test anxiety and completed a sleep inventory with reference to the past 30 days. In Study 2, a sample of 188 subjects provided measures of trait and state test anxiety and completed a sleep inventory for the night preceding an actual test. The results of Study 1 and Study 2 confirmed that test anxiety is associated with self-reported sleep disturbance. In addition, the results of Study 2 showed that sleep disturbance is also associated with increased state test anxiety. Finally, it was found in Study 2 that sleep disturbance was not related to actual test performance. However, poorer test performance was associated with increased state and trait test anxiety. It is concluded that certain characteristics associated with test anxiety are stable and may be detected in evaluative and non-evaluative situations. The results are discussed with particular reference to their implications for the test anxiety construct itself as well as treatment strategies for the test-anxious student.  相似文献

Luc Schneider 《Axiomathes》2013,23(2):419-442
Nexuses such as exemplification are the fundamental ties that structure reality as a whole. They are “formal” in the sense of constituting the form, not the matter of reality and they are “transcendental” inasmuch as they transcend the categorial distinctions between the denizens of reality, including that between existents and non-existents. I shall advocate a moderately particularist view about (external) nexuses and argue that it provides not only the best solution to Bradley’s regress, but also an elegant account of symmetrical relations (both formal and material), as well as of temporal and modal change. These advantages are illustrated by the reconstruction of an Aristotelian ontology of exemplification involving substances, kinds and material attributes.  相似文献

In four experiments, participants made a speeded manual response to a tone and concurrently selected a cued visual target from a masked display for later unspeeded report. In contrast toaprevious study of H.Pashler (1991), systematic interactions between the two tasks were obtained. First, accuracy in both tasks decreased with decreasing stimulus (tone-display)-onset asynchrony (SOA)— presumably due to a conflict between stimulus and response coding. Second, spatial correspondence between manual response and visual target produced better performance in the visual task and, with short SOAs, in the tone task, too— presumably due to the overlap of the spatial codes used by stimulus- and response-selection processes. Third, manual responding slowed down with increasing SOA — reflecting either a functional bottleneck or strategic queuing of target selection and response selection. Results suggest that visual stimulus selection and manual response selection are distinct mechanisms that operate on common representations.  相似文献
